Lando Norris, a British Formula One driver, remains confident in his ability to compete for the championship despite skepticism about his credentials. He openly rejects the conventional, aggressive archetype that champions are expected to embody, stating that he wants to win while preserving his integrity. Currently leading the championship with the fastest car on the grid, Norris acknowledges the challenge posed by teammate Oscar Piastri. During his career, he has faced tough competitors and has shown resilience in coping with personal challenges, including confidence and mental health struggles.
I still believe I can be a world champion but doing it by being a nice guy.
I'd rather just be a good person and try to do well.
